Summer Youth Employment 2015
Program Highlights
Enjoy a 6 week paid work experience during the summer months in a position that matches your career interests!
Enrollment in an OSHA 10 Hour general safety class Participation in the FDIC Financial Stability Program
“Money Smarts for Young Adults” 10 Hour “Work Readiness” certificate Guest speakers from various career clusters including;
COX, Fidelity Investments, RI State Police, FM Global, CVS, Citizens Bank
Earn money while you explore a career of interest & improve your work skills.

Eligibility
14 to 24 years old-as of July 7, 2015 Rhode Island Resident (not Providence or
Cranston) Valid SS # Eligible to work in US Registered with Selective Service (males 18+)
Additional Requirements
Must be available for the entire length of the 6 week program: July 7, 2015 - August 14, 2015
Must complete appropriate employment forms if selected for participation.
Must complete evaluation upon completion of the 6 week program.
Application Process
Schedule an appointment. Submit completed application & all required
documents within established time frame determined at initial appointment.
Completion of pre-program assessments (academic & vocational).
Documents required to complete applications
Birth Certificate Social Security Card Report Card State ID, School ID, Drivers License or
Passport
